当前位置:首页 / EXCEL

Excel如何使用对话框?如何设置对话框实现功能?

作者:佚名|分类:EXCEL|浏览:66|发布时间:2025-03-26 20:10:30

Excel如何使用对话框?如何设置对话框实现功能?

在Excel中,对话框是一种强大的工具,可以帮助用户进行各种设置和操作,从而提高工作效率。对话框通常用于显示选项、提示用户输入信息或提供操作结果的窗口。以下将详细介绍如何在Excel中使用对话框,以及如何设置对话框来实现特定的功能。

一、Excel中常用的对话框类型

1. “文件”选项卡中的对话框

“另存为”对话框:用于保存工作簿。

“打开”对话框:用于打开工作簿。

“另存副本”对话框:用于保存工作簿的副本。

2. “开始”选项卡中的对话框

“查找和选择”对话框:用于查找和选择单元格或单元格区域。

“条件格式”对话框:用于设置单元格的格式条件。

3. “插入”选项卡中的对话框

“图表”对话框:用于创建图表。

“图片”对话框:用于插入图片。

4. “格式”选项卡中的对话框

“单元格格式”对话框:用于设置单元格的格式。

“页面设置”对话框:用于设置打印页面。

二、如何使用Excel对话框

1. 打开对话框

在Excel中,点击相应的选项卡,找到并点击对应的对话框按钮或命令。

例如,要打开“另存为”对话框,可以在“文件”选项卡中点击“另存为”。

2. 操作对话框

在对话框中,根据需要选择或填写相关信息。

例如,在“另存为”对话框中,可以选择保存位置、输入文件名、选择文件格式等。

3. 关闭对话框

完成操作后,点击对话框的“确定”按钮。

如果不需要保存更改,可以点击“取消”按钮关闭对话框。

三、如何设置对话框实现功能

1. 使用VBA编写代码

通过VBA(Visual Basic for Applications)编写代码,可以自定义对话框的功能。

例如,可以创建一个包含多个按钮和文本框的对话框,用于执行特定的操作。

2. 使用表单控件

在Excel中,可以使用表单控件来创建简单的对话框。

例如,可以插入复选框、单选按钮、文本框等控件,并通过设置控件属性来实现特定的功能。

3. 使用ActiveX控件

ActiveX控件是一种可以在Excel中使用的可重用的软件组件。

通过ActiveX控件,可以创建复杂的对话框,实现更多功能。

四、示例:创建一个简单的对话框

以下是一个简单的示例,演示如何使用VBA创建一个包含按钮和文本框的对话框:

```vba

Private Sub CommandButton1_Click()

Dim myDialog As Object

Set myDialog = Application.Dialogs(xlDialogFileNew)

With myDialog

.Show

' 在这里可以添加代码,根据对话框中的操作执行相应的功能

End With

End Sub

```

在这个示例中,我们创建了一个名为`myDialog`的对话框对象,并调用了`Show`方法来显示对话框。在对话框显示后,可以根据需要添加代码来处理用户在对话框中的操作。

相关问答

1. 如何在Excel中快速打开“查找和选择”对话框?

在Excel中,按下`Ctrl + F`键可以快速打开“查找和选择”对话框。

2. 如何在Excel中使用VBA创建自定义对话框?

使用VBA编写代码,通过`Application.Dialogs`集合访问Excel的内置对话框,或者使用`UserForm`对象创建自定义对话框。

3. 如何在Excel中设置单元格格式?

在“开始”选项卡中,点击“格式”按钮,然后选择“单元格格式”对话框,在对话框中设置所需的格式。

4. 如何在Excel中保存工作簿?

在“文件”选项卡中,点击“另存为”,选择保存位置,输入文件名,然后点击“保存”按钮。

5. 如何在Excel中使用ActiveX控件?

在“开发工具”选项卡中,点击“控件”组中的“其他控件”,选择ActiveX控件,然后在工作表中拖动以创建控件。